Loving the bike now that I'm convinced the vibration is not to worry about. Here's my latest topic. I have V&H longshots and I'm thinking about toning down them down a bit, not too much. V&H makes a quiet baffle but they recommend rejetting if I install them. So I'm wondering about just wrapping the existing baffles with more fiberglass or stuffing with steel wool. What do you guys think? And is rejetting really necessary?
